Tourism Deptt showcases Kashmir’s hospitality at Visakhapatnam

Jammu: The department of tourism J&K participated in the 8th Convention of Association of Domestic Tour Operators of India (ADTOI) at Visakhapatnam to promote J&K as a preferred tourist destination.

The 3-day annual Convention was inaugurated by the Chief Minister of Andhra Pradesh N. Chandrababu Naidu on November 17, 2017 in presence of Tourism Minister Bhuma Akhila Priya Reddy, top bureaucrats and a galaxy of tourism personalities of the country.

The theme of the convention is “Explore India – One Country, Many Worlds.” The business sessions will focus on new ideas, the MICE industry, weddings, and infrastructure growth.

Deputy Director Tourism Kashmir Waseem Raja led the team of J&K tourism including leading tour operators from all the three regions of the state.

Waseem Raja gave the presentation on J&K tourism by screening recently launched 5-minute film “Warmth Place on Earth” produced on the theme of Kashmir hospitality and other videos on tourism which mesmerized audience drawn from different parts of the country and other countries.

Waseem Raja also took part in the panel discussion describing the social causes undertaken by the tourism stake holders and bigger hotel chains by taking care of natural resources and extending social support to local villagers at certain levels and locations.

Director Tourism Kashmir Mahmood A Shah said participation of the department in the travel marts, road shows and annual conventions at national level helps promote tourism at the right platform where hundreds of the leading tour operators from across the country and other countries participate.

Notably, ADTOI convention is one of the largest conventions of tour travel operators in the country.

Over 300 tour and travels operators from different states participated in the convention.

Those who attended the Convention besides Chairman PILTOF Nasir Shah are Mir Anwar President TASK, Zahoor Qari incoming TAAI Chairman, Showkat Pakhtoon, Secretary General PILTOF, Noor Shangloo Treasurer JKTA, Ather Yameen Secretary General TASK, Haseeb Khan, Inder Pal Singh, Jammu Chapter Chairman of PILTOF, Sonam Wangchuk LADAKH Chapter Chairman of PILTOF.
